Should A Born Again Christian Date A Non-Christian, Why Not?

One frequently asked question from young people who are seeking to start or build a  relationship with a partner is whether it is advisable to date a non-christian. Maybe they met a good guy or girl that they like and ticks all their boxes but wait, he or she not a Christian. “Does it really matter, can’t I just go ahead and date, then, hope and pray that they will become born-again Why can’t I date the non-Christian” they ask.

As a Born-again Christian, there are teachings in the word of God (The Bible) that our faith is built on. Some of these foundational truths are our core beliefs that we hold very dearly and when a Christian is in a relationship with someone who doesn’t belief these core truths, it may become a challenge.

One of such if not the most important of our core beliefs as Born-again Christians is; “Jesus is the son of God, He is the only way, truth and life, He died on the cross, rose on the third day, and ascended to Heaven.”

If your partner or someone you are dating doesn’t believe in this, believes in something contrary from another religion or believes in absolutely nothing, this may become a challenge. One or both parties would either feel like there’s a disconnect in their mutual faith/beliefs or one of them may always try to preach or convince the other of their faith and this may cause  differences or a divide. The possibilitiesare  endless when it comes to what could happen or arise from this scenario.

For a docile Christian, who isnt a student of the word it wouldn’t mean much. But for the Born-again Christian who is Holy Spirit filled, active in church, prays and preaches the word, this will be a challenge in the relationship. Also it will be a hindrance to the growth of the Christian in their walk with God because their partner isn’t inspiring or challenging them to grow or  become a better Christian. Prov 27:17

So, who should a Christian accept to be in a relationship with? The bibles says “Do not be unequally yoked together with unbelievers: for what fellowship hath righteousness with unrighteousness? .. ” 2 Corinthians 6:14

When deciding on whom to date, look out for one who is a born-again Christian, believes what you believe, is willing to grow in faith with you, loves God and the things of God, love you unconditionally, willing to start a Godly relationship with you and someone who upholds christian values. Let this be your first compatibility check.
